Abstract
A device for cooling a metal rolling stock (1) rolled in a rolling train, having multiple cooling devices (4), to which water (5) is supplied via a respective branch line (7) and by means of which the water (5) is applied to the rolling stock (1). The branch lines (7) are equipped with a respective valve (8), by means of which the water flow flowing through the respective branch line (7) is adjusted. Each of the valves (8) is paired with a drive (9), via which the respective valve (8) is actuated. The cooling devices (4) form multiple groups, each of which is paired with a dedicated pressure vessel (10) in a proprietary manner. Each pressure vessel (10) is connected to a respective feed line (12) at a respective connection point (11), and the water (5) is supplied to the branch lines (7) of the cooling devices (4) of the corresponding group via said feed line. When viewed in the flow direction of the water (5), each connection point (11) is arranged upstream of the valves (8) of the respective group of cooling devices (4).
